Job Description
As an Insights and Shopper Insights Manager at Unilever, you will play a crucial role in driving growth opportunities and enhancing efficiency in the e-commerce channel. Your responsibilities will include:
- Representing the voice of the shopper by integrating Unilever shopper and category knowledge with custom research.
- Providing insights that inspire transformational business actions and contribute to sustainable marketplace impact.
- Leading e-commerce and shopper insights initiatives, gaining a deep understanding of omnichannel shopper behavior and decisions.
Key Expectations:
- Insights Leadership:
- Offering a fact-based, strategic, and shopper-centric viewpoint.
- Communicating the voice of the shopper, including attitudes, behaviors, motivations, barriers, and pain points.
- Connecting insights to create integrated, inspiring category growth stories for informing business decisions.
- Effective Deployment and Content:
- Driving impactful media capabilities on e-commerce to enhance brand superiority.
- Reinforcing deployment principles and driving efficiency.
- Fill Knowledge Gaps:
- Identifying foundational and channel-specific knowledge gaps in e-commerce.
- Creating and leading a research agenda to deliver actionable insights.
- Analytical Proficiency:
- Comfortably analyzing sales, panel, and social media data.
- Leveraging data sources to provide actionable learnings and insights aligned with business objectives.
Key Competencies:
- Strong Bias for Action: Ability to drive quick results, pivot when needed, and find new solutions.
- Simplifies Complexity: Proficient at interpreting complex business challenges, identifying issues and opportunities proactively.
- Visionary & Innovative: Skilled at trend spotting, continuous learning, collaboration, and process reinvention.
- Result-Oriented: Motivated by outcomes and committed to achieving desired results efficiently.
- Quest for Learning: Open to learning, exploring new territories, and accelerating personal growth.
Key Job Requirements:
- Minimum 5 years of insights and primary research experience in CPG, retail, or e-commerce sectors.
- Proficient understanding of the e-commerce business landscape.
- Strong project management skills, capable of end-to-end management of the research process.
Skills required: panel data analysis, Project Management, Primary Research
